Yoga is a mind-body practice with roots in Hindu philosophy that has become a significant subject of academic study across disciplines including health sciences, religious studies, sociology, and Asian philosophy. Students examine it both as a spiritual tradition and as a contemporary wellness intervention, making it intellectually rich territory. Its dual identity — ancient philosophical system and modern therapeutic tool — invites analysis from medical, cultural, and ethical angles. Courses in alternative medicine, stress management, pain research, and complementary and alternative medicine (CAM) modalities regularly assign essays on yoga because it sits at the intersection of physical health, mental well-being, and cultural practice.

Student papers on this topic take several distinct approaches. Some focus on clinical and physiological benefits, examining how yoga addresses conditions such as rheumatoid arthritis or chronic pain through relaxation and controlled movement. Others take a religious or philosophical angle, exploring the yogas of Hinduism or situating practice within broader Asian philosophy. Comparative essays weigh yoga-based approaches against conventional medicine, while more specialized papers consider its relationship to professional dance through traditions like Hatha Yoga. Cultural immersion and sociological frameworks also appear, reflecting how yoga functions as both individual practice and social phenomenon.

A strong essay on yoga benefits from a clearly scoped thesis that commits to one angle — medical, philosophical, or cultural — rather than attempting to cover all three at once. Evidence drawn from clinical studies carries weight in health-focused papers, while textual and historical sources strengthen philosophical arguments. A common pitfall is treating yoga as a monolithic practice; acknowledging its varied forms and contexts produces more credible, nuanced analysis.
